Skip to content

Commit 2afdd6b

Browse files
author
Daman Arora
committed
use findByIdIncludingRemoved for volume retrieval in snapshot policy validation
1 parent 2941b51 commit 2afdd6b

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

server/src/main/java/com/cloud/storage/snapshot/SnapshotManagerImpl.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1925,7 +1925,7 @@ public boolean deleteSnapshotPolicies(DeleteSnapshotPoliciesCmd cmd) {
19251925
if (snapshotPolicyVO == null) {
19261926
throw new InvalidParameterValueException("Policy id given: " + policy + " does not exist");
19271927
}
1928-
VolumeVO volume = _volsDao.findById(snapshotPolicyVO.getVolumeId());
1928+
VolumeVO volume = _volsDao.findByIdIncludingRemoved(snapshotPolicyVO.getVolumeId());
19291929
if (volume == null) {
19301930
throw new InvalidParameterValueException("Policy id given: " + policy + " does not belong to a valid volume");
19311931
}

0 commit comments

Comments
 (0)